What Should You Budget For?

When purchasing a home, it's important to budget beyond the purchase price.

Buyers should also plan for:

  • Land transfer tax

  • Legal fees

  • Home inspection

  • Appraisal fees

  • Title insurance

  • Utility setup costs

  • Moving expenses

Having a complete financial picture helps avoid surprises during the closing process.

Commuting Around the GTA

One of Bram West's biggest advantages is its location.

Residents enjoy quick access to:

  • Highway 401

  • Highway 407

  • Highway 410

  • Mississauga Road

  • Financial Drive

  • Steeles Avenue

Whether you work in Brampton, Mississauga, Milton, or Toronto, Bram West provides convenient transportation options.

Should You Buy a Newer Home or an Older Home?

Both options have advantages.

Newer homes may offer:

  • Modern layouts

  • Energy-efficient construction

  • Updated finishes

  • Smart home technology

Older homes may provide:

  • Larger lots

  • Mature landscaping

  • Established streets

  • Potential renovation opportunities

The right choice depends on your priorities and long-term plans.


Common Mistakes Buyers Make

Many buyers focus only on the home itself and overlook the neighbourhood.

Some common mistakes include:

  • Not reviewing recent comparable sales

  • Ignoring future development plans

  • Skipping a home inspection

  • Buying at the top of their budget

  • Not getting mortgage pre-approval before shopping
